New York: Bulfinch Press, 2004. First Edition. Hard Cover. Fine/Fine. 8x1x10. First edition. Includes 2 Audio CDs. An exceptional copy. 2004 Hard Cover. 185 pp. A compilation of firsthand accounts of the Normandy invasion presents forty oral histories that recount the events of D-Day from the perspectives of the veterans themselves, accompanied by a selection of interviews on CD.
